    Nice video, after disassembly the phone can remain still ip68?

    • @PBKreviews
      @PBKreviews  2 ปีที่แล้ว

      Thanks! If you replace the adhesive with original pre cut adhesive, then yes it will retain the ip68. But for this phone, it doesn't seem like the pre cut adhesive is easy to find or available to order online. Most of the time, back cover/battery door replacements would come with the pre cut adhesive pre installed but not always.

    This is just another normal phone where is the ruggedness.

    • @PBKreviews
      @PBKreviews  2 ปีที่แล้ว

      The whole phone is built around ruggedness. The entire housing is rubberized plastic with reinforced metal plates around the frame and is made to withstand dirt/debris as well as water. The screen is reinforced with a plastic layer screen protector as well with gorilla glass 6 screen to withstand drops.
